标签: authentication iis asp.net-web-api authorization windows-authentication
我需要获得公司名称这是基本的事情。但我的问题是我需要通过WEB API获取它们。我已尝试在启用Web身份验证的Windows身份验证中将impersonate设置为true。当我运行postman时,我可以在本地获取详细信息,但是当我在服务器中部署后尝试访问时,它显示以下内容:
1)公司域名返回空 2)拒绝访问(当匿名设置为禁用模式时)
我很困惑,是否可以在没有Windows身份验证提示框的情况下完成此操作。如果是,我在配置IIS时错过了什么? 提前谢谢大家:)
答案 0 :(得分:0)
现在回答这个问题为时已晚,但是我需要SSO,并且遇到了Ping Identity。
因此,使用SSO,我可以获取已登录用户的详细信息。
PingIdentity - SSO